What Does a Skin Brightening Cream Do?
Skin-brightening creams are generally designed to improve the appearance of uneven skin tone, dullness, and areas of hyperpigmentation.
Your natural skin color is determined largely by melanin. Healthy skincare should focus on maintaining the skin and addressing concerns such as sun-induced pigmentation, post-acne marks, and uneven tone rather than trying to remove melanin completely.
A suitable brightening product may contain ingredients that help improve the appearance of dark spots over time.
Results depend on the ingredient, concentration, cause of pigmentation, and consistency of use.
Why Do Men Develop Uneven Skin Tone?
Uneven pigmentation can happen for several reasons.
Sun Exposure
Regular exposure to ultraviolet radiation can contribute to tanning, pigmentation, and visible skin aging.
Men who work outdoors, drive frequently, play sports, or spend a lot of time in direct sunlight may notice more tanning or dark spots.
This is why sunscreen is an essential part of any brightening routine.
Acne and Post-Acne Marks
Pimples can sometimes leave dark marks after they heal. These marks are known as post-inflammatory hyperpigmentation.
Picking or squeezing acne can increase the chance of developing noticeable marks.
Shaving
Frequent shaving may cause irritation, especially when using an unsuitable razor or shaving technique. Repeated irritation can contribute to an uneven appearance in some individuals.
Dryness and Poor Skincare Habits
Dehydrated skin can appear dull and rough. Using harsh soaps, scrubbing aggressively, or skipping moisturizer can make the skin feel uncomfortable and affect its overall appearance.
Important Ingredients to Look For
When shopping for a brightening cream, the ingredient list is more useful than the marketing headline.
Niacinamide
Niacinamide is a form of vitamin B3 commonly used in skincare. It can support the skin barrier and is often included in products designed to improve the appearance of uneven skin tone.
It is generally considered a versatile ingredient and can be suitable for different skin types.
Vitamin C
Vitamin C is an antioxidant frequently used in brightening skincare. It can help protect the skin from environmental oxidative stress and may improve the appearance of uneven pigmentation when used consistently.
Vitamin C formulas can vary considerably, so proper storage and product stability are important.
Alpha Arbutin
Alpha arbutin is another ingredient commonly found in products targeting the appearance of dark spots and uneven pigmentation.
It is often used in targeted brightening formulas rather than as a general moisturizer.
Kojic Acid
Kojic acid is used in some pigmentation-focused skincare products. It can be effective for certain concerns but may cause irritation in sensitive individuals.
If you have sensitive skin, introduce active ingredients carefully.
How to Choose a Cream for Your Skin Type
The best brightening cream is not necessarily the strongest one. It should suit your skin and be comfortable enough to use consistently.
Oily Skin
If your skin becomes greasy quickly, look for lightweight lotions or gel-cream textures.
Non-comedogenic products may be worth considering if you are prone to clogged pores.
Avoid choosing a heavy cream simply because it is marketed as a powerful brightening product.
Dry Skin
Dry skin generally benefits from formulas that provide both hydration and skin-supporting ingredients.
Look for moisturizing ingredients such as glycerin, ceramides, hyaluronic acid, or other emollients.
A brightening product that leaves your skin dry and irritated may ultimately make your routine harder to maintain.
Sensitive Skin
Sensitive skin requires extra caution with active ingredients.
Choose a simple formulation and avoid ingredients that have previously caused irritation. Introduce new products gradually and consider patch testing when appropriate.
If a product causes persistent burning, redness, swelling, or discomfort, stop using it and seek professional advice if needed.
Why Sunscreen Is Essential for Brightening
Using a brightening cream without protecting your skin from the sun can make it difficult to maintain an even-looking complexion.
UV exposure can contribute to tanning and pigmentation. It can also counteract the progress you are trying to make with your skincare routine.
Use a broad-spectrum sunscreen during the daytime and reapply according to the product directions, particularly after sweating, swimming, or prolonged outdoor exposure.
For men who spend a lot of time outside, sunscreen is arguably one of the most important products in a pigmentation-focused skincare routine.
How to Use a Brightening Cream Correctly
A simple routine is usually easier to maintain than a complicated one.
Morning Routine
Start with a gentle cleanser.
Apply a suitable moisturizer if needed, followed by broad-spectrum sunscreen.
If your brightening cream is intended for morning use, follow its product directions and apply it before sunscreen.
Evening Routine
Cleanse your face to remove dirt, sweat, sunscreen, and other buildup.
Apply your treatment or brightening cream as directed. Finish with moisturizer if your skin needs additional hydration.
Avoid layering several strong active ingredients at once unless you know that the combination is suitable for your skin.
How Long Do Brightening Products Take to Show Results?
One of the biggest mistakes people make is expecting overnight results.
Pigmentation develops over time, so improving its appearance usually requires patience and consistency.
The time needed can vary depending on the cause and severity of pigmentation and the ingredients used in the product.
Taking photographs under similar lighting conditions can be a more useful way to monitor gradual changes than checking your skin in the mirror every few hours.
If pigmentation does not improve, becomes worse, or appears suddenly, consider consulting a dermatologist.

Common Mistakes to Avoid
Using Too Many Active Ingredients
Combining several brightening products can increase the risk of irritation.
Start with one targeted product and build your routine gradually.
Skipping Moisturizer
Some active ingredients can leave the skin feeling dry. A suitable moisturizer helps maintain a comfortable skin barrier.
Forgetting Sunscreen
Sun exposure can contribute to pigmentation and make your skincare goals harder to achieve.
Trusting Instant Whitening Claims
Claims of dramatically changing your natural complexion within a few days should be treated cautiously.
Healthy skincare focuses on improving skin condition and reducing the appearance of uneven pigmentation rather than promising an unrealistic transformation.
Frequently Asked Questions
Can men use skin-brightening creams?
Yes. Skincare ingredients are generally selected based on skin type and concern rather than gender.
Is skin brightening the same as skin whitening?
Not necessarily. Brightening usually refers to improving dullness and uneven pigmentation, while “whitening” is often used as a marketing term. Healthy skincare should focus on an even, healthy-looking complexion.
Can a cream remove dark spots completely?
No cream can guarantee complete removal of every dark spot. Results depend on the cause, severity, ingredients, and consistency.
Do I need sunscreen with a brightening cream?
Yes. Daily sun protection is important when your goal is to manage uneven pigmentation and maintain an even-looking complexion.
Can I use a brightening cream every day?
It depends on the product and its ingredients. Follow the manufacturer’s instructions and reduce or stop use if you develop significant irritation.
